Title: A Glimpse into the Innovations of Daniel Nelson Harres

Introduction: Daniel Nelson Harres, a prolific inventor based in Belleville, IL, has made significant strides in the field of optical technology. With an impressive portfolio of 29 patents, he has developed groundbreaking inventions that enhance our understanding and application of fluid dynamics and optical communications.

Latest Patents: Among his most recent patents are the **Optical Airflow Sensor** and the **Phase Lock Loop for Optical Wireless Network**. The Optical Airflow Sensor utilizes a unique design where an optical fiber bends in response to fluid flow. A light source transmits light through the fiber, while surrounding optical sensors receive this light, allowing for precise estimation of fluid flow velocity. The Phase Lock Loop for Optical Wireless Network comprises a platform equipped with an optical transmitter and detector, along with a phase-locked loop circuit. This invention facilitates the transmission of information through optical signals by managing time intervals and enhancing communication efficiency.
